Homestead is located on a 12.6 acre parcel in South Hero, Vermont on the shores of Lake Champlain. The site consists of an open meadow that slopes easterly to the lake. The region is notable for its agrarian landscape of pastoral farms.

Dulwich Hill Vaults is alterations and additions to an existing freestanding cottage in Sydney’s inner west. The project retains the existing house and introduces new living spaces in a structure to the rear directly connected to the garden.
